Output e21c113f218d160d4818e9cebbd4396f704577391c0453cc352b0c4d4c5ff8cc:0

value
1448400
script pubkey
OP_0 OP_PUSHBYTES_20 2d3d07b4b719365802abe9a2ae17629db02a1049
address
bc1q957s0d9hrym9sq4tax32u9mznkcz5yzfyhy393
transaction
e21c113f218d160d4818e9cebbd4396f704577391c0453cc352b0c4d4c5ff8cc
confirmations
97486
spent
true